Working with Parents to Support Children’s Behaviour

This module introduces the principles of building collaborative partnerships and maintaining behavioral consistency between families and Early Years settings across the UAE. It explains the core communication strategies required to cultivate trust and ensures that educators and parents work hand-in-hand to provide seamless, aligned behavior support across both home and school environments.

Learners explore the foundations of empathetic communication, how to approach sensitive topics with shared decision-making, and why cultural responsiveness plays a critical role in long-term family engagement. The module highlights the shared responsibility among educators, parents, and external specialists to build unified routines that remove barriers to a child's social and emotional development.

It reflects current parent engagement frameworks and community partnership expectations monitored by the MOE, KHDA, SPEA, and ADEK.
